Difference between Prosody and Inflection

What is the difference between Prosody and Inflection?

Prosody as a noun is the study of rhythm, intonation, stress, and related attributes in speech. while Inflection as a noun is a change in the form of a word that reflects a change in grammatical function.

Prosody

Part of speech: noun

Definition: The study of rhythm, intonation, stress, and related attributes in speech. The study of poetic meter; the patterns of sounds and rhythms in verse.

Inflection

Part of speech: noun

Definition: a change in the form of a word that reflects a change in grammatical function.a change in pitch or tone of voice.a change in curvature from concave to convex or from convex to concave.a turning away from a straight course.
